This can include heavy duty work such as outdoor
cleaning, or it can be indoor cleaning. It can also be as specific as
cleaning offices. Cleaning is just like landscaping-it's something that
needs to be done, and most
people hate doing it, so they'll be glad to
pay you to do it for them. If you're going to do this, you may need to
bring your own equipment-especially for outdoor cleaning. You may need a
rake, trash bags, gloves, and window cleaner. For indoor cleaning, you
may need an all purpose cleaner, broom, dust pan, rags or small towels,
trash bags, a mop, and furniture polish. As far as your pricing, check
to see what other companies similar to yours are charging, and what
people in your area are willing to pay. Make sure you charge enough to
